The so-called “digital fracture” mainly affects older people and with the aim of avoiding it one sentence of the month of July The Supreme Court has nailed one clapped a Treasury, which in March 2019 decided to establish the obligation to present the income statement only for internet.

The high court considers that “it is established in a general way for all taxpayers without determining the assumptions and conditions that justify, in consideration of reasons of financial, technical capacity, professional dedication or other reasons, that this obligation is imposed”, when it is a right to be able to make the declaration electronically.

The Supreme loves the resource of the Spanish Association of Tax Advisors against the judgment of the National Court that had rectified the order. Like this, possibly already in the next appointment with the personal income tax taxpayers will be able to choose to file their income either in person or electronically.

“It cannot impose the mandatory use of computer media to citizens and must provide the necessary guarantees through electronic techniques to comply with tax procedures, but not the obligation to do so only through theseĀ».

For Justice, the imposition of the electronic channel as the only one to comply with Treasury incurs discriminatory treatment for the elderly in particular, less expert in general terms with new technologies.
